Module 33: Architectural Styles (Optional)
Outcome
Investigate architectural styles from various periods and geographical regions.
Indicators
(a) Research how individual needs, cultures, religions and social perspectives have influenced architectural styles.
(b) Analyze qualities that distinguish various historical architectural styles (e.g., Indigenous, European, American) and discuss how they have influenced contemporary housing.
(c) Create a representation (e.g., pictorial timeline, video) of significant architectural designs from various periods and geographical regions.
(d) Compare historically and architecturally significant roofing types.
(e) Investigate contributions of renowned architects (e.g., Clifford Wiens, Frank Lloyd Wright, Julia Morgan, Joseph Pettick, Michelangelo).
(f) Explore implications of urbanization (e.g., low density vs. high density communities) on architectural styles.
(g) Explore implications of geography (mountain versus valley dwellings, warm versus cold climate regions) on architectural styles.
(h) Explore local or regional heritage buildings for their unique architectural and historical significance.
(i) Research relevant by-laws related to heritage building conservation.
(j) Discuss the benefits and challenges of heritage building restoration.

Architecture. Residential Drafting and Design(12th ed.)
This architectural textbook contains quality images and well written chapters that delve into many of the drafting concepts. The initial chapters provide background information about drafting fundamentals and the subsequent chapters explore Architectural Planning; Plan Development; Construction Systems and Supplemental Drawings; Presentation Methods; Electrical, Plumbing and Climate Control; and Specifications and Estimating Costs. The chapters include a summary, review questions, suggested activities and internet resources.

Tutorial Guide to AutoCAD 2021: 2D Drawing, 3D Modeling
This tutorial guide offers clearly written instructions, explanations, diagrams, suggested dimensions and projects which enable users to gain knowledge and practice skills on the computer using AutoCAD 2021. The initial chapters begin with the basic tools and commands. Subsequent chapters introduce intermediate and more advanced tools and commands. Many 2D drawings and projects, as well as 3D models and ideas are included in this resource.
